A 60% shared ownership 3 bedroom property with a conservatory extension and well landscaped rear garden. Two off road parking spaces. Restricted to first time buyers only with a local connection to the area.
Downstairs there is a spacious entrance hall with cloakroom.
The kitchen/dining room is fitted with a good range of storage units with tiled effect vinyl flooring and space for a dining table or breakfast bar.
The living room to the rear offers a generous reception room with door through to a conservatory extension which overlooks the garden and is currently used as a family dining area.
Upstairs there are two double bedrooms and single bedroom with a modern family bathroom.
Outside is an enclosed rear garden with a raised decked patio with covered open shelter, ideal for outside entertaining with a storage shed adjacent and side access gate.
To the side of the property there are two allocated off road parking spaces.
Services: Mains electricity, gas, water, & drainage.
Council Tax: Band C - Mid Devon District Council.
Tenure: Leasehold
Share value: 60% shared ownership
Full market price: £237,500
Length of lease: 106 years
Monthly Rent: £180.76
Next rental Increase: April 2026
Service Charges to include buildings insurance £31.31pcm
Buyer Requirements:
First time buyers only with a local connection to the area & able to meet the income requirements for the monthly rent. A local connection is classified as someone living or working in the area or who have close family living there (parents, siblings, children).
The property has restricted staircasing to ensure the property remains affordable for future generations of local buyers with only 80% ownership possible.
Highland Park lies a short walk from the centre of the popular village of Uffculme, with a good range of local amenities, including a popular primary school, and the renowned, Ofsted rated 'Outstanding' secondary school, Uffculme School. There is a local pub, mini-markets, doctors' surgery, veterinary practice, a large village hall and community playing fields. Regular bus services run through the village and the market towns of Tiverton and Cullompton are a short drive away. Via the motorway, Exeter and Taunton are within easy reach, as well as Tiverton, with the popular Blundell's School and Petroc College of Further and Higher education.
The popular Tiverton Golf Course and Westcountry Golf Academy (WGA) Golf Course & Driving Range lie within easy reach, for the keen golfer and Exeter Chiefs, at Sandy Park, and Somerset Cricket Club in Taunton, are also very convenient!
Cullompton and Junction 28 of M5 c.5 miles
Junction 27 of M5 c. 2 miles
Exeter c. 17 miles
Taunton c. 20 miles
Tiverton c. 8 miles
Tiverton Parkway Station c. 2.5 miles
